منتدى فيجوال بيسك لكل العرب | منتدى المبرمجين العرب

نسخة كاملة : تحديد مسار قاعدة بيانات أكسس Access اثناء تشغيل البرنامج VB.net
أنت حالياً تتصفح نسخة خفيفة من المنتدى . مشاهدة نسخة كاملة مع جميع الأشكال الجمالية .
السلام عليكم ايها الاخوة الكرام 
طبقت درسا مهما للاستاذ احمد ناجر في موضوع تحديد مسار قاعدة بيانات أكسس Access اثناء تشغيل البرنامج 
ولكن انا اردت ان اطبقه على مشروعي فعجزت بحيث اردت ان احمل البيانات  مباشرة على DataGridView  عن طريق Settings
ارجو المساعدة في هذه الفكرة المهمة للجميع
فى البداية انت لا تحتاج ان تجعل اسم قاعدة البيانات فى Settings

كل ما عليك استبدال السطر التالى
كود :
Public con As New OleDbConnection("Provider=Microsoft.ACE.OLEDB.12.0;Data Source=" & My.Settings.conStr & "")

بهذا السطر
كود :
Public con As New OleDbConnection("Provider=Microsoft.ACE.OLEDB.12.0;Data Source=" & Application.StartupPath & "\data1.accdb")

اكمل مشروحك وسيعمل معاك بدون اى مشكلة

تحياتى لك
وتمنياتى لك التوفيق
شكرا اخي في الله الelgokr على المساعدة القيمة

لقد وجدت الخطأ وهو انني مكرر con مرتين الاولى في الفورم و الثانية  في الموديل



شكرا واعيد تحميل المرفق بعد التصحيح لمن يحتاجه
الشكر لله

واحسن الله لك فيما فعلت اخى كريم جودي 
فى توضيح ما قمت من حل دون ترك الموضوع على وضعه
حتى تعم الفائدة لمن يواجه مثل تلك الامور

فتحياتى لك
وتمنياتى لك التوفيق